#d86925 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d86925 is composed of 84.7% red, 41.2%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.4% magenta, 82.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 22.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d86925 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d24a with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d86925 color description : Strong orange.

#d86925 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d86925 has RGB values of R:216, G:105,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.83,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14182693.

Shades and Tints of #d86925

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0703 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d86925

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807e7d is the less saturated color, while #f56208 is the most saturated one.
